Environmental change, especially climate change, is significantly intensifying and increasing the frequency of natural disasters. The warming of the planet alters earth’s climatic systems, leading to more extreme weather events. These changes affect disasters related to weather and water such as droughts, floods, storms and wildfires.
How environmental change drives Natural Disasters:-The primary mechanism is the increase in global temperatures, which affects the planets energy and water cycles. This leads to a domino effect on various weather patterns and natural hazards.
Droughts and Wildfires:-Higher temperatures increase evaporation, which can lead to more prolonged and intense droughts in many regions. Dry soil and vegetation create a tinder box, making it easier for wildfires to start and spread rapidly. This also lengthens the wildfire season.
Flooding:-The combination of more intense rainfall and rising sea levels contributes to more frequent and severe flooding. Coastal areas are particularly vulnerable as rising sea levels make storm surges more powerful. Heavy precipitation can overwhelm river system spread in land flooding.
Heat waves:-As average global temperatures rise, the frequency and intensity of heat waves increase. These extreme heat events can be deadly causing heat-related illnesses and putting stress on infrastructure.
The Vicious Cycle:-Environmental change and natural disasters can create a feedback loop. For example, wild fires, which are made worse by climate change, release vast amounts of carbon dioxide and other green house gases in to the atmosphere, contributing to further warming and a higher risk of future fires.Similarly, the destruction of costal ecosystems like mangroves and coral reefs by powerful storms reduces natural protection against future storm surges and erosion.
Environmental Change is not just a driver of natural disasters, it is a fundamental amplifier, making them more frequent more intense and more destructive. The efforts go beyond just a warming climate, encompassing a range of human caused environmental shifts that weaken the planet’s natural defenses.
Climate change:-The primary catalyst Climate change is the most significant factor linking environmental change to disasters. The increase in global average temperatures, driven primarily by the burning of fossil fuels, fundamentally alters Earth’s climate system.
Extreme Weather:-A warmer atmosphere holds more moisture, , leading to more intense rainfall and severe flooding. This same heat also increases evaporation from land, making droughts longer and more severe, which in turn fuels larger and more frequent wildfires.
Warming Oceans:-The oceans absorb a significant amount of this excess heat, this warming provides more energy for tropical storms, incrasing their wind speed and destructive power. Hurricane and typhoon seasons are becoming more intense, with “once –in a hundred –years” storms happening with alarming frequency.
Sea level rise:-The expansion of warming ocean water and the melting of glaciers and ice sheets are causing global sea levels to rise. This makes costal areas more vulnerable to storm surges and flooding permanently inundating low lying regions.
Environmental degradation and Disaster Risk:-Beyond climate change, human-induced environmental degradation directly increases the risk of certain natural disasters. This involves changes to land and ecosystems that remove natural barriers and increase vulnerability.
Deforestation:-Forests act as natural sponges, absorbing rainwater and anchoring soil with their roots when forests are cleared, this vital function is lost. This leads to increased surface run off, which can trigger severe flooding and landslides. Deforestation also exacerbates droughts by disrupting local rainfall patterns.
Wet land destruction:-Wetlands such as marshes and swamps are crucial for flood control. They act as natural flored plains, storing excess water and releasing it slowly. When wetlands are filled in for development, this buffer is removed, increasing the risk of urban and rural flooding.
Costal Ecosystem Loss:-Costal Ecosystems like mangrove forests and coral reefs are a community’s first line of defense against powerful surges and erosion. When these are destroyed by development or pollution, coastal communities are left exposed and highly vulnerable to the full force of hurricanes and other storms.
